Smoked Salmon Appetizer Bites : Elegant, Easy & Crowd-Pleasing

These smoked salmon appetizer bites are the perfect blend of creamy, smoky, and fresh. With just a few ingredients, you can create a beautiful, no-cook appetizer that feels fancy but is incredibly easy to assemble. Whether you’re hosting a dinner party, brunch, or holiday gathering, these bites bring flavor and elegance to any spread—without the stress.

Ingredients

Scale

4 oz smoked salmon (sliced)

1/2 cup cream cheese (softened)

1 tbsp lemon juice

1 tbsp fresh dill or chives, finely chopped

1 mini cucumber (thinly sliced)

1216 crackers, cucumber rounds, or toasted baguette slices

Optional: capers, cracked black pepper, or lemon zest for topping

Instructions

In a small bowl, mix cream cheese, lemon juice, and chopped herbs until smooth and spreadable.

Lay out your base (crackers, cucumber slices, or toast).

Spread each with a dollop of the herbed cream cheese.

Top with a small ribbon of smoked salmon.

Garnish with capers, a sprinkle of herbs, or a touch of lemon zest.

Serve chilled or at room temperature.
